图书介绍

在实战中成长C++开发之路pdf电子书版本下载

在实战中成长C++开发之路
  • 钟岱晖编著 著
  • 出版社: 北京:电子工业出版社
  • ISBN:9787121083310
  • 出版时间:2009
  • 标注页数:392页
  • 文件大小:26MB
  • 文件页数:407页
  • 主题词:C语言-程序设计

PDF下载


点此进入-本书在线PDF格式电子书下载【推荐-云解压-方便快捷】直接下载PDF格式图书。移动端-PC端通用
种子下载[BT下载速度快] 温馨提示:(请使用BT下载软件FDM进行下载)软件下载地址页 直链下载[便捷但速度慢]   [在线试读本书]   [在线获取解压码]

下载说明

在实战中成长C++开发之路PDF格式电子书版下载

下载的文件为RAR压缩包。需要使用解压软件进行解压得到PDF格式图书。

建议使用BT下载工具Free Download Manager进行下载,简称FDM(免费,没有广告,支持多平台)。本站资源全部打包为BT种子。所以需要使用专业的BT下载软件进行下载。如 BitComet qBittorrent uTorrent等BT下载工具。迅雷目前由于本站不是热门资源。不推荐使用!后期资源热门了。安装了迅雷也可以迅雷进行下载!

(文件页数 要大于 标注页数,上中下等多册电子书除外)

注意:本站所有压缩包均有解压码: 点击下载压缩包解压工具

图书目录

第一篇 知识准备 2

第1章 Visual Studio 2008 2

1.1 Visual Studio 2008简介 2

1.1.1 简介 2

1.1.2 版本介绍 3

1.2 Visual C++2008简介 4

1.2.1 Visual C++2008版本 4

1.2.2 Visual C++2008项目模板 7

1.2.3 Visual C++2008中的新增功能 7

1.2.4 Visual C++2008中的重大变更 10

小结 10

第2章 使用Visual C++2008 11

2.1 简介 11

2.2 项目和解决方案 11

2.2.1 使用项目和解决方案 11

2.2.2 使用解决方案资源管理器 12

2.2.3 添加源文件 14

2.3 生成项目 14

2.4 测试项目 15

2.5 调试项目 16

2.6 部署程序 17

小结 18

第3章 MFC 19

3.1 什么是MFC 19

3.2 为什么选择MFC 21

小结 21

第4章 UML 22

4.1 什么是UML 22

4.2 UML包含的元素 22

4.3 在软件开发的不同阶段对应的UML 25

小结 25

第二篇 从简单的程序开始 28

第5章 文件管理器 28

5.1 项目概述 28

5.2 知识点介绍 28

5.2.1 关于字符及编码 28

5.2.2 字符串操作 31

5.2.3 文件操作 32

5.2.4 对话框 33

5.3 项目分析 35

5.4 项目实现 35

5.4.1 搭建用户界面 36

5.4.2 获取系统文件目录结构 42

5.4.3 文件过滤 50

5.4.4 文件类别 51

5.4.5 文件管理 57

小结 60

第6章 配置参数 61

6.1 模块概述 61

6.2 知识点介绍 61

6.3 模块分析 65

6.4 功能实现 66

6.5 项目整合 74

6.5.1 保存用户自定义设置 74

6.5.2 读取用户自定义设置 76

小结 78

第7章 在项目中学习 79

7.1 几种字符串类型 79

7.1.1 字符串类型的对比 79

7.1.2 使用CString类 83

7.2 字符串列表和字符串数组 89

7.2.1 字符串数组(CStringArray) 89

12.2 配置数据库 134

12.3 搭建系统主界面 135

小结 136

第13章 系统登录 137

13.1 用户界面及相关处理 137

13.2 后台处理 139

小结 145

第14章 服务端管理 146

14.1 服务端系统设置 146

14.2 用户信息管理 151

14.3 公告管理 174

小结 185

第15章 服务管理 186

15.1 实现通信模块 186

15.2 实现协议解析模块 190

15.3 控制服务的启动与关闭 194

小结 199

第四篇 即时通信系统―客户端 202

第16章 客户端项目分析 202

16.1 整体分析 202

16.2 活动分析 205

小结 208

第17章 搭建客户端框架 209

17.1 建立解决方案 209

17.2 添加数据传输类 210

17.3 建立应用程序通信协议 210

17.4 数据分发与封装处理 217

小结 223

第18章 系统登录 224

18.1 建立登录界面 224

18.2 增加连接参数设置 225

18.3 增加登录验证 225

18.4 增加服务端验证处理 230

18.5 连接参数配置 233

小结 235

第19章 加载系统主界面 236

19.1 建立系统主界面及所需的加载页 236

19.2 建立加载页与主对话框的关联 239

19.3 载入客户端初始化信息 242

19.3.1 加载用户信息 242

19.3.2 加载用户列表 245

19.3.3 加载公告列表 254

19.4 显示信息 258

19.4.1 组织信息 258

19.4.2 用户信息 260

19.4.3 公告信息 262

小结 266

第20章 配置、聊天及文件传输 267

20.1 个性化参数配置 267

20.2 聊天处理 271

20.3 文件传输处理 278

小结 291

第21章 企业即时通信的商业扩展 292

21.1 即时通信模块 292

21.2 视频会议模块 293

21.3 用户定义模块 293

21.4 系统管理模块 293

21.5 后台管理模块 294

小结 295

第22章C++/CLI 296

22.1 语言关键字 297

22.2 托管类型 298

22.2.1 声明一个托管类类型 298

22.2.2 一个CLI的引用类对象的声明 300

22.2.3 CLI数组的声明 305

22.2.4 析构函数语义的变化 307

22.3 类或接口中的成员声明 311

22.3.1 属性声明 311

22.3.2 属性索引声明 313

22.3.3 委托和事件 315

22.3.4 密封一个虚函数 317

22.3.5 操作符重载 318

22.3.6 转换操作符 319

22.3.7 接口成员的显式重写 320

22.3.8 私有虚函数 321

22.3.9 静态常量整型的连接方式 322

22.4 值类型及其行为 322

22.4.1 CLI枚举类型 323

22.4.2 隐式装箱 326

22.4.3 装箱值的跟踪句柄 327

22.4.4 值类型语义 328

22.5 语言变化概要 332

22.5.1 字符串 332

22.5.2 参数数组和省略号 334

22.5.3 typeof改为T::typeid 335

22.5.4 强制转换符号和safe_cast<>简介 335

22.6 推动修订版语言设计 339

小结 345

附录A 几种常用的网络通信模型 346

附录B 数据库设计 367

附录C Micorsoft Access 2007 378

附录D Visual Studio 2010简介 387

精品推荐